Failed exports in the Pellworth reporting service can be retried through the internal retry endpoint. Support staff should first confirm the export status is `failed` rather than `pending`, since retrying a pending job creates duplicates. Retries are idempotent within a 24-hour window and return the original export identifier. The endpoint accepts up to five retries per job. All retry requests must authenticate against the internal jobs service using the key shown below.

API key for tagef-fafop: vxb2-ta

- [ ] **Step 7: Breaker override escrow.** After sealing the signing keys for the Tallgrove upstream API circuit breaker, confirm the support team can force the breaker open during a full outage. The override bundle lives in the sealed escrow drawer and is useless without its unlock phrase. Two ceremony witnesses must initial this step before proceeding. The escrow bundle is decrypted with the recovery passphrase that follows.

vault phrase of kahip-kahop = holath-quenmir

Meeting notes — receiving site briefing, Halverton print job

Discussed transfer of master copies from Fennick Print House to the Halverton receiving dock. Masters arrive Thursday, single sealed crate, flagged priority. Dock staff to verify seal intact before signing. Any damage gets photographed and reported to Ines before opening. Storage is the climate room, shelf two. The courier hand-over instruction is noted below.

dispatch memo: the lamwyn fenwyn courier leaves the wenir ledger at gate 7175 under passcode 822969

For this week's sync: we will validate compatibility checks across the `orders.v3` and `inventory.v2` event families, covering backward, forward, and full transitivity modes. Each case registers a mutated schema and asserts the expected rejection code. Negative cases include field deletion without defaults and enum narrowing. All calls go through the Harkness gateway in the Velden staging cluster, so authenticated requests are mandatory. Test runners should attach the shared staging credential on every registry call, shown below.

session JWT of yawep-yawep = eyJhbGciOiJIUzI1NiIsInR5cCI6IkpXVCJ9.eyJzdWIiOiI3pWF3_In0.aXYsHiog